帝国cms迁移到zblog的方法

zblog by 黄业兴 at 2020-05-07

1、先把cms的分类对应的添加到zblog的分类上。

2、分类迁移

INSERT INTO `lz`.`lz_category` (
    `cate_ID`,
    `cate_Name`,
    `cate_Order`,
    `cate_Type`,
    `cate_Count`,
    `cate_Alias`,
    `cate_Intro`,
    `cate_RootID`,
    `cate_ParentID`,
    `cate_Template`,
    `cate_LogTemplate`,
    `cate_Meta`
)SELECT
        classid,
        classname,
        '0',
        '0',
        '1',
        classpath,
        classpagekey,
        '0',
        '0',
        '',
        '',
        classpagekey
FROM
gyw.www_92game_net_enewsclass

2、文章迁移

INSERT INTO `zblog`.`zbp_post` (
    `log_ID`,
    `log_CateID`,
    `log_AuthorID`,
    `log_Tag`,
    `log_Status`,
    `log_Type`,
    `log_Alias`,
    `log_IsTop`,
    `log_IsLock`,
    `log_Title`,
    `log_Intro`,
    `log_Content`,
    `log_PostTime`,
    `log_CommNums`,
    `log_ViewNums`,
    `log_Template`,
    `log_Meta`
) SELECT
    a.id,
    a.classid,
    1,
    '',
    0,
    0,
    '',
    0,
    0,
    a.title,
    a.smalltext,
    b.newstext,
    a.newstime,
    0,
    0,
    '',
    ''
FROM
    sq_nbb.www_92game_net_ecms_news as a,sq_nbb.www_92game_net_ecms_news_data_1 as b
where a.id = b.id

3、因为zblog内容没有去掉\所以增加一个stripslashes()函数

我用的模板是tpure 文件位置:zb_users/theme/tpure/template/post-single.php

{php}
echo stripslashes($article->Content);
{/php}

已经有0条评论!

验证码 点击刷新